Summary: The PLM QA Engineer role involves working with a leading online fashion retailer to ensure high-quality software delivery through automation and testing. The position requires expertise in Centric PLM, Playwright, SpecFlow, and RestAPI, with responsibilities including scenario preparation, sprint testing, and collaboration with cross-functional teams. This is a hybrid position based in London, UK, with a temporary contract duration of six months. The role emphasizes continuous improvement in testing processes and methodologies.
